
What do Kleenex, the Winter Olympics, Band-Aids, Caesar salad and College Royal at the University of Guelph all have in common?
They all turn 100 in 2024.
For those unaware, College Royal is the largest student-run university open house in North America.
And it started in 1925.
“It was started by a group of people who wanted to show livestock,” Lexi Johnston, a Bachelor of Science in agriculture student and current president of College Royal, told Farms.com. “So, the roots of College Royal really run deep in ag.”
